A man and a woman who are both carriers for cystic fibrosis are using in vitro fertilization and preimplantation genetic diagnosis to ensure their offspring will not be afflicted by cystic fibrosis.In the procedure, a cell is removed from the embryo at the eight-cell stage and analyzed for the mutant genes.An embryo that is not homozygous for the mutation is implanted in the woman and develops normally.Because development is normal in the embryo after a cell has been removed, you can conclude that human development
A) involves autonomous specification of blastomeres.
B) is regulative during early cleavage stages.
C) is mosaic and cells are determined early in development.
D) involves determinants that specify the fates of different blastomeres early in development.
E) involves informational molecules produced from the maternal genome and stored in the egg and distributed to different blastomeres.
